  • Virtue ethics focuses on the character of the individual and emphasizes the importance of moral virtues such as honesty, courage, and compassion over material possessions.
  • Materialism, on the other hand, prioritizes the acquisition of material wealth and possessions as the primary sources of happiness and fulfillment.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ves cultivating moral virtues and character traits that lead to a flourishing and meaningful life.
  • Material possessions are often temporary and can be lost or taken away, whereas virtues are internal qualities that cannot be easily taken away.
  • Virtue ethics encourages individuals to focus on developing their character and moral principles rather than accumulating wealth or possessions.
  • Materialism can lead to a shallow and superficial way of life, where happiness is equated with the possession of material goods rather than inner fulfillment.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ves making ethical choices based on moral principles rather than self-interest or material gain.
  • Virtue ethics emphasizes the importance of cultivating virtues such as wisdom, courage, and justice in order to lead a good and fulfilling life.
  • Materialism can lead to a sense of emptiness and dissatisfaction, as the pursuit of material possessions often fails to provide lasting happiness or fulfillment.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ves embracing a set of moral principles and values that guide one's actions and decisions.
  • Virtue ethics encourages individuals to reflect on their actions and motivations, and to strive towards becoming a better and more virtuous person.
  • Materialism can lead to a constant desire for more wealth and possessions, creating a cycle of never-ending consumption and dissatisfaction.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ves valuing relationships, community, and personal growth over the pursuit of material wealth.
  • Virtue ethics emphasizes the importance of moral excellence and the cultivation of virtues as a way to achieve eudaimonia, or flourishing and well-being.
  • Materialism can lead to a sense of alienation and disconnection from others, as the focus on material possessions can overshadow the importance of human relationships and connections.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ves recognizing the intrinsic value of moral virtues and character traits over external markers of success or status.
  • Virtue ethics emphasizes the importance of self-reflection, self-control, and self-improvement as essential components of leading a virtuous life.
  • Materialism can lead to a sense of competition and comparison with others, as individuals often judge their success and worth based on their material possessions.
  • Embracing virtue over materialism in philosophy involves living in accordance with one's values and principles, even when faced with temptations or challenges.
  • Virtue ethics emphasizes the importance of cultivating virtues such as honesty, integrity, and fairness in order to promote a more just and ethical society.
